Disclosure Documents (Selling Your Home)


The Disclosure Request form is used to order the appropriate Homeowners Documents for selling your home.  The form can be downloaded by clicking on the link in the left column and returning the completed form with payment to the Association Office.  Below are explanations of the fields that need to be addressed.    

 

Seller/Owner Name: 

Name of the homeowner's.

 

Property Address:

This should be the house number & street name where the home is located in Ashburn Farm.

 

Settlement Date:

Supply the date if available.  If not available, leave blank or indicate N/A.

 

Settlement Company:

Provide the settlement company name (this is where you go to settle on the property). As in the above, if this is not available at the time the request for the Homeowner Disclosure packet is requested - leave blank or indicate N/A.

 

Contact Information: (Important!)

This is the contact information the Association Staff uses to provide notification to when the package is completed and ready to be picked up. You can supply multiple phone numbers as applicable - i.e., Home Phone, Cell Phone, etc.

 

Signature of Requester:

Signature of the homeowner

 

Date:

The date the form is signed.

 

The Disclosure Request form can be faxed to the Association Office at 703-729-0247.  However, the request will not be processed until payment is received. Payment (cash or check only - payable to AFA) is required before processing the request. All Disclosure Packets MUST be picked up and signed for at the Ashburn Farm Association Office (no packages are mailed). You will be notified by phone when the packet is completed and ready to be picked up. This process requires 14 calendar days from the date the request is received by the Association Office.

 

The cost for a new request is $200.00 (non-refundable) - cash or check only - for Single Family, Townhomes (Townhomes inlclude "Patio Homes").  Disclosure packets for Condo's is $100.00 because there is no external inspection done by the Ashburn Farm Association on this type of property.  An update to the original package is $50.00. 

 

For a description of the contents of this packet - please refer to the "Frequently Asked Questions" link.

 

 

PUD (Planned Unit Development) Questionnaires


Questionnaires, usually required for refinancing purposes, are to be faxed to the Association Office 703-729-0247. The fee and turnaround are noted below (effective October 5, 2005):

 

Fee Turnaround
$ 75.00 3 - day

 

Note:  Additional charges may apply if requests are received for a 24 - hour turnaround. Call ahead 703-729-6680 for more information.

 

Companies can fax the questionnaire, and a "copy" of the check to 703-729-0247 (Attention Cheri).  The check can then be sent overnight delivery to the association office (21400 Windmill Drive, Ashburn, VA 20147).  When the check is received the finalized questionnaire will then be faxed to the requested source along with a copy of the Certificate of Insurance for the Common Area and the Association's budget information.
